(1950-2007) Creek/ Seminole
Born in Phoenix, AZ, this artist's native name is LOGA translating to turtle. Hence, his preference is to sign his paintings with LOGA, drawn in the shape of a turtle.
Mitchell won awards for his work beginning in the early 1970's. His work has been exhibited in many venues including New York, New Jersey, Colorado, Oklahoma and in Wisconsin.
Patrick Lester's volume The Biographical Directory of Native American Painters references this artist.
